Daily Roundup of Key US Economic Data for June 20
Jun 20, 2025 11:55 AM

02:34 PM EDT, 06/20/2025 (MT Newswires) -- The Philadelphia Federal Reserve's manufacturing reading remained at minus 4 in June, still indicating modest contraction in the sector after a sharp decline in the New York Fed's Empire State reading earlier in the week.

The Conference Board's Leading Economic Index fell by 0.1% in May after a 1.4% drop in April. The Conference Board said that it does not anticipate recession but does see a slowdown in growth in 2025 compared with a year earlier.

US manufacturing output falls in April on weak auto production
US manufacturing output falls in April on weak auto production
May 26, 2025
WASHINGTON (Reuters) - Factory output dropped 0.4% last month after an upwardly revised 0.4% gain in March, the Federal Reserve said on Thursday. Economists polled by Reuters had forecast production would slip 0.2% after a previously reported 0.3% rise. Production at factories increased 1.2% on a year-over-year basis in April.
